Transaction 3ab23f1461dfa530b276d91ce158915800f0d66b930050898346068386a4bdaf

1 Input
2 Outputs
  • 3ab23f1461dfa530b276d91ce158915800f0d66b930050898346068386a4bdaf:0
  • value  1101021
    address  1HV6F9WFU7BhKcF1hiG4LvyxGvZqgDXi9o
  • 3ab23f1461dfa530b276d91ce158915800f0d66b930050898346068386a4bdaf:1
  • value  4341281
    address  1551ThwRDQZ8kGoNrNBbjfTb3YJpzQSBZf